Job Closed
This listing is no longer active.
As a pioneer for digital transformation GFT develops sustainable solutions across new technologies.
Desenvolvedor Angular, AWS – Pleno/Sênior
Location
Brazil
Posted
4 days ago
Salary
0
Seniority
Senior
Job Description
Desenvolvedor Angular, AWS – Pleno/Sênior
GFT Technologies
• Contribuir de forma global na construção e evolução das aplicações. • Participar de refinamentos, inceptions e cerimônias ágeis. • Auxiliar no desenho e definição de soluções técnicas. • Colaborar com o time para a entrega das histórias dentro das sprints. • Disseminar conhecimento, boas práticas de desenvolvimento e arquitetura. • Atuar com senso de dono (ownership) sobre os produtos e soluções.
Job Requirements
- Experiência sólida com Angular 15+;
- Familiaridade com componentização e reutilização de componentes;
- Experiência no desenvolvimento de aplicações web executadas em WebView;
- Conhecimento em arquitetura de Micro Frontends (Module Federation);
- Conhecimento em integração com BFF (Backend for Frontend);
- Conhecimento em APIs RESTful;
- Conhecimento de microserviços e integrações com serviços corporativos;
- Qualidade e Boas Práticas - Testes unitários com Jest.
- Testes automatizados com Cypress;
- Aplicação de princípios SOLID, Clean Code e Clean Architecture;
- Conhecimento de versionamento de código utilizando Git, GitHub e GitFlow;
- Boas práticas de acessibilidade e desenvolvimento inclusivo;
- Conhecimento em responsividade e performance de aplicações front-end;
- Design System e Experiência do Usuário;
- Experiência com IDS (Itaú Design System);
- Conhecimento em IDL;
- Aplicação de boas práticas de acessibilidade utilizando Design Systems.
- Conhecimento em AWS, incluindo:
- o S3
- o CloudFront
- o Lambda
- o API Gateway
- o ECS
- o EC2
- o KMS
- o Terraform
- o Esteiras de Deploy e CI/CD;
- Observabilidade e monitoramento de aplicações, preferencialmente com Datadog.
- Conhecimento em Kotlin;
- Experiência com integrações via Caronte, requisições HTTP para BFF e entendimento dos serviços bancários;
- Implementação de tagueamento e mensuração com Google Analytics 4 (GA4).
Benefits
- Cartão multi-benefícios – você escolhe como e onde utilizar.
- Bolsas de Estudos para cursos de Graduação, Pós, MBA e Idiomas.
- Programas de incentivo à Certificações.
- Horário de trabalho flexível.
- Salários competitivos.
- Avaliação de desempenho anual com plano de carreira estruturado.
- Possibilidade de carreira internacional.
- Wellhub e TotalPass.
- Previdência Privada.
- Auxílio-Creche.
- Assistência Médica.
- Assistência Odontológica.
- Seguro de Vida.
Related Guides
Related Job Pages
More Frontend Engineer Jobs
Elevate K-12 Educator
Fullmind LearningFullmind Learning, formerly iTutor, is an e-learning company on a mission to ensure all children have access to an exceptional education. The company partners w
Role Description Join our pool of educators who have access to our educator portal, where you can select the jobs aligned to your certification as they become available according to our school and district partners! This is a 1099 Independent Contractor position following the school district's calendar. Immediate start dates are based on available placement opportunities upon completion of the application process. As a Fullmind educator, you will: - Have access to our educator portal where you can select the jobs you take on as a Fullmind educator. - Promote creativity and excitement in the virtual learning environment. - Create strategies to engage and nurture student learning and student relationships. - Create lesson plans aligned with the class curriculum. - Keep track of student grades and performance. Qualifications - Must be authorized to work in the United States. - Must have a Bachelor's Degree from an accredited college/university. - Laptop or desktop computer, webcam, headset, and reliable internet access. - Submit a background check as part of the application process. Requirements - Current Elevate K-12 educator. Benefits - This is a contract position and does not include benefits.
Front-End Developer II – ShareGate Protect
ShareGateThe leading Microsoft 365 migration and governance platform
• Ship high-quality, performant front-end features in React and TypeScript that meet UX standards from the earliest milestones; • Translate user needs into shipped experiences that solve the real problem (not just the spec), in tight partnership with Product and Design; • Grow a reusable component library and design system that speeds up delivery across the team; • Step into the backend when needed: read existing code and extend or add functionality so delivery isn't blocked at the front-end boundary; • Deliver interfaces that hold up to real-world performance, accessibility, and responsiveness expectations; • Help shape front-end architecture and engineering practices that scale beyond the first release; • Keep the codebase healthy and maintainable through reviews, testing, and continuous improvement; • Influence product and technical decisions through active participation in team discussions.
• Lead the design and development of scalable, performant user interfaces using React and modern frontend technologies • Set technical direction for frontend architecture, state management, data flow, and component design • Build complex workflows and UI components for data-rich, operational applications • Develop interfaces that support real-time data, situational awareness, and operator decision-making • Contribute directly to implementation while guiding the team through technical tradeoffs and execution • Mentor frontend engineers and help raise the technical bar across the team • Lead code reviews, design discussions, sprint planning, and technical planning for frontend work • Help break down ambiguous product and technical requirements into clear execution plans • Promote engineering best practices around performance, testing, maintainability, accessibility, and reliability • Partner with engineering leadership to support team growth, hiring, onboarding, and development • Integrate frontend systems with backend services via REST, GraphQL, and real-time data interfaces • Optimize rendering performance for large datasets, map-based views, streaming data, and real-time updates • Ensure responsive, reliable performance across devices, browsers, and operating environments • Identify and resolve frontend performance bottlenecks across the platform • Own and evolve frontend architecture, including state management, data flow, build tooling, testing strategy, and component organization • Build and maintain reusable component libraries, design systems, and shared UI patterns • Ensure frontend systems are scalable, maintainable, testable, and easy for other engineers to extend • Establish patterns that support multiple products, mission workflows, and customer-facing applications • Drive technical consistency across frontend codebases and applications • Partner with backend, platform, autonomy, product, and design teams to deliver end-to-end features • Collaborate with UX/design to ensure high-quality implementation and operator-focused user experiences • Translate complex operational requirements into intuitive, reliable frontend workflows • Work with stakeholders to balance speed, usability, performance, and technical quality • Represent frontend engineering in product planning, architecture reviews, and roadmap discussions
• Join a team of experienced developers who design and evolve products used at scale • Build high-performance, high-quality user interfaces using React and TypeScript • Participate in technical and product decisions • Contribute to conversations about the value delivered to customers, performance, accessibility, and the long-term quality and maintainability of our front end




